Transaction 5e09667c46e17b1a3189fdcea89add491fbd5d3460f2482d6f1d1c959dfec9c9
1 Input
1 Output
-
5e09667c46e17b1a3189fdcea89add491fbd5d3460f2482d6f1d1c959dfec9c9:0
- value
- 359674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23aa8427bbb4c24e82e0316cda577968651ed784 OP_EQUAL
- address
- 34wbqw5n9QSptkaU9Refvkaws24JfBrxuz